Improving quality of care and outcome at very preterm birth: the Preterm Birth research programme, including the Cord pilot RCT [PDF]
BACKGROUND:Being born very premature (i.e. before 32 weeks’ gestation) has an impact on survival and quality of life. Improving care at birth may improve outcomes and parents’ experiences.

Systematic review and network meta-analysis with individual participant data on cord management at preterm birth (iCOMP): study protocol [PDF]
Introduction Timing of cord clamping and other cord management strategies may improve outcomes at preterm birth. However, it is unclear whether benefits apply to all preterm subgroups.
